Summary
SLC35G5 (solute carrier family 35 member G5, HGNC:15546) is a protein-coding gene on chromosome 8p23.1, encoding Solute carrier family 35 member G5 (Q96KT7).
This gene is intronless and probably arose from retrotransposition of a similar gene. It has high sequence similarity to the gene encoding acyl-malonyl condensing enzyme on chromosome 17.

Protein
Protein identifiers
Solute carrier family 35 member G5 — Q96KT7 (reviewed: Q96KT7)
Alternative names: Acyl-malonyl-condensing enzyme 1-like protein 2
All UniProt accessions (1): Q96KT7
UniProt curated annotations — full annotation on UniProt →
Subcellular location. Membrane.
Tissue specificity. Expressed in placenta and testis.
Miscellaneous. The gene encoding this protein appears to have arisen by SVA-mediated retrotransposition of the SLC35G6 gene in the primate lineage.
Similarity. Belongs to the SLC35G solute transporter family.
